Transaction 8403676cab0cfa4b3563fa9e1aea52158a3e0f3787703cf459ddb5e2a20bee4f

11 Input
1 Outputs
  • 8403676cab0cfa4b3563fa9e1aea52158a3e0f3787703cf459ddb5e2a20bee4f:0
  • value  200000
    address  3CTV8e5b3wHkpDU3WuYDLAxkwHt2suph2t